What it's made of and why it matters
The Podium bottle body is polyethylene (PE), a thermoplastic polymer with low chemical reactivity and minimal leaching risk under normal use conditions. The cap is polypropylene (PP), also stable and food-contact approved in most jurisdictions. Absence of Teflon-family coating coatings means no Teflon-type coating-related fume risk from overheating. Neither material contains inherent BPA or phthalates in their base polymer structure, though additives in manufacturing could theoretically introduce them if not managed.

If you buy it
Use only for cold or room-temperature water; do not fill with hot beverages, as PE softens above 50-60 C and can leach additives. Replace the bottle every 2-3 years or when interior discoloration, cloudiness, or odor develops, as polymer degradation increases leaching risk over time. Wash by hand in cool water rather than dishwasher to minimize thermal stress on the material. Check the cap seal monthly; worn caps allow bacterial growth in residual moisture.
